Interpretation

This track marks a softer register in Rusko's catalog — a moment where the bass weight is maintained but the emotional temperature rises toward something genuinely tender. The production balances dubstep's structural grammar with melodic elements that pull the track toward more conventional emotional territory, and the vocal presence carries a pleading quality that gives the title its full weight. The phrase performs double duty: the literal request for patience in an interpersonal context and the physical invitation to brace for bass pressure, and Rusko's production understands both meanings simultaneously. The groove is still rooted in half-step rhythmic logic, but the arrangement breathes more openly, allowing melodic lines to establish themselves before the bass reasserts its authority. There's a romanticism here somewhat unexpected given the genre's typical emotional range, speaking to the dancefloor as a place where longing is felt collectively — the club as a space for processing difficult feelings through movement rather than suppressing them through constant maximalism. The track fits late-night moments when the energy has softened from peak intensity to something more intimate, when the music invites individual reflection rather than crowd participation. For listeners who experienced UK dubstep's transition from underground listening music to festival headliner territory, it documents the genre's expanding emotional range during a formative period.
